Letter from Specialist Freestone


Greetings from Joint Base Balad, Iraq! Hi, my name is Bobby Freestone. I'm an Army Specialist/E-4 with the 5th Engineer Battalion, deployed to Joint Base Balad, Iraq. I received your care package today, March 31, from Lt. Brooks. It was such a wonderful surprise! Mostly, because I'm the battalion mail clerk. I gave Lt. Brooks a large box; she gave me one of the boxes that came inside of it. I'm originally from New York. I was born in Poughkeepsie and I was raised in the Hudson Valley, Wappinger's Falls, Beacon, Fishkill, etc. I haven't been back there since '90. I am very thankful and grateful to Operation Shoebox New Jersey and the wonderful support of the volunteer staff and the K-2nd grade students, staff and parents of Orchard Hill School in Montgomery, N.J. who took the time to make my evening suddenly very special. Again, thank you all so very much for all you do for us over here. It is extremely appreciated! Sincerely, Specialist Freestone 5th Engineer Battalion Joint Base Balad, Ir
